Weekly summary for Campbell
May 4, 2026 to May 10, 2026 • Updated May 6, 2026
In Campbell this week, permitting-related activity focused primarily on updates from the Santa Clara County Board of Supervisors, which discussed housing and community development programs as well as waste reduction and recycling initiatives that may influence local permitting considerations. While no new city-specific permitting decisions or proposals were reported, these county-level discussions provide important context for Campbell’s permitting environment. Key points: - The Santa Clara County Board of Supervisors received an annual report from the Office of Supportive Housing covering housing and community development programs. - The Board also addressed waste reduction and recycling programs that could impact permitting policies. - No new Campbell city council or planning commission permitting agenda items or decisions were recorded this week. What to watch: Future Campbell city meetings for any direct permitting proposals or updates influenced by county housing and environmental initiatives.
